Single Cabin Beds

Single cabin beds come in many styles, and can be customized to meet your requirements. They may be used for couples or for singles and have numerous features to keep in mind when selecting one. You must consider whether you will be sleeping in a low, mid, or high sleeper, and you should also consider safety features.

panana-mid-sleeper-bunk-bed-3ft-single-bed-frame-wood-cabin-bed-for-kids-white-661.jpgLow sleeper

A single cabin bed with a low sleeper is a great choice for smaller rooms. It provides plenty of storage space without taking up too much space on the floor. To maximize the storage space in your space you can also put a desk underneath.

This bed is great for anyone of any age. Cabin beds provide safe, secure places for kids to sleep and play. They also have the best storage solutions built into them.

You can pick from a variety of options of add-ons and styles for cabin beds for kids. Some cabin beds are equipped with an underbed play tent.

Certain models of cabin beds include under-bed drawers. These drawers are ideal to store items that are too small to fit in an armoire. Toys, books and clothes can be easily stored in these drawers.

If you're looking to allow your child more space to play in, consider purchasing an XL cabin bed. The bed can be put in the middle of the room or along the wall. There are a myriad of designs for the XL bed including corner twin corner, bridging, corner and corner.

There are a number of cabin beds for children who are younger and those who are older will appreciate their sleek, modern lines. For teens, they can choose a high-sleeper that allows them to have more space for movement. double cabin bed beds also come with fun features such as built-in lighting and the ability to pull out closets, a chalkboard side panel, or a fixed ladder.

If your child is considering an in-cabin bed, make sure to make sure that all the components are in the correct position. You could put your child's safety at risk. Additionally, it is recommended to keep the safety label on the bed frame.

There are a variety of options for single cabin beds that can sleep one person, depending on your budget. Some are constructed of top quality materials, while others are more affordable. Additionally, if your child's room is small, you can choose an option that is easily moved to a new spot.

These beds are great because you can pick the color and style. You can choose from white or natural bed. You can also get LED lighting or a canopy.

Mid-sleeper

A single pine cabin bed with a mid-sleeper bed is the perfect solution for bedrooms that are small. They are small and offer plenty of storage. They also have a multifunctional design. It can be used as a desk, bed as well as a play space. If you are looking for a solution for your bedroom for your child it's a great option to consider.

The mid-sleeper bed is great for kids because it provides them with an ensconced and secure place to sleep. Children will be able to sleep high. To make it more comfortable, add a nightlight.

They can also keep their belongings safe from the view of others. This is particularly beneficial for children in the early years. There are many cabin beds that include an under-bed play tent. For additional convenience there are cabin beds that have a small ladder.

Mid-sleeper beds may have drawers and a desk built in. This is especially useful when your child needs the use of a desk. Some beds for teens have a desk that pulls out that can be fitted into the frame of the bed.

The single cabin mid sleeper bed is stylish and secure way to ensure that your child gets an adequate night's sleep. It is essential to adhere to the safety requirements of the manufacturer when purchasing the bed. It is also important to keep the safety label from the mattress.

As with all bed products you must always inspect the bed frame, fixings and every other component of the bed to ensure that they are not damaged or missing. You might not want to join items that are not intended for the bed.

Cabin beds are very popular with children due to their practical and fun design. A lot of them come with under-bed drawers. A trundle bed can be added to your room when you don't have enough.

There are many types of single cabin mid-sleeper beds. They can be designed to match a child's bedroom theme. They're great for primary school kids who need a place to study.

Whatever type of bed you decide to purchase, it is important to consider the size of your room to ensure that it can fit. You should also check the mattress to make sure it's the right size.

High-sleeper

A single cabin bed that has a high sleeping position is a fantastic way to maximize the space in your child's bedroom. This bed gives children the chance to learn and play on their own. They are also ideal for small bedrooms.

You can pick from a variety of sizes and designs to suit your child's needs. Some high-sleeper beds have built-in storage. A high sleeper bed that has a full-length desk is a good choice for children who are fascinated by gaming. This will allow you to have several screens, including the PC tower as well as a console.

Before buying a bed, you should measure the area where it will be placed. This is especially important for children less than five years old. Also, ensure that your child has enough headroom. For safety reasons it is recommended that the bed has a minimum of 15cm of depth.

A high-sleeper should be equipped with an safety rail on both sides. This will help prevent the risk of accidents. You can hang curtains or fairy lights based on the size of your bed.

You can ensure that your child is safe by making sure that your high-sleeper is not placed in direct sunlight or any other objects. A night light must be installed in the room.

High-sleeper beds are recommended for children older than six years. These beds are not recommended for children younger than six years old. children. They may be a little too high, and thus increase the risk of accidents.

If you are thinking of buying a high sleeper for your child, ensure it comes with a mattress that is a suitable size for them. It is also essential to check for any damage. Always follow the manufacturer's directions.

For older children, high-sleepers can be a fantastic space-saving solution. These beds offer a huge amount of space for studying and play, while leaving space underneath to store things. Most beds include a desk as well as shelves, providing your child a place to store their books and games.

Safety features

Cabin beds are an excellent alternative if you're looking for a safe method to sleep. They provide comfortable sleeping and safety features that prevent accidents. These safety features are important to prevent injuries. Apart from that cabin beds, they are durable and robust.

kids-mid-sleeper-bed-happy-beds-kimbo-anthracite-grey-wood-contemporary-desk-drawers-shelf-storage-bed-cabin-bed-3ft-single-90-x-190-cm-frame-only-652.jpgA good cabin bed can also be a great alternative to a traditional bunk bed. The bed is designed for two people and comes with an additional railing to keep children from falling off. Some children might slip and become trapped between the wall and the bed. In such situations children may suffer injuries or even die. It is for this reason that it is crucial to ensure that the railings on the bunk are in good working order and free from protrusions and other potential sources of snags.

If you are buying a cabin bed be sure it is in compliance with the standards of the US Consumer Product Safety Commission. This agency sets standards for the design and construction, as well as the materials used in these beds. There are strict regulations regarding the dimensions of the space between the guardrails and the mattress. Also, you can check the labels to ensure that the bed meets the standards.

Another good aspect to consider when buying a bunk bed is the type of fasteners. They must be smooth and slightly recessed. This will stop sharp points from becoming. Before putting together your bed it is crucial to study the instructions. It is important to pay close attention to the position of the bed, and avoid placing blinds, ceiling fans, or heaters in the wrong location. Other dangers to look out for include books, toys and light fixtures.

In general you should not allow children to play on the top bunk beds cabin of a cabin bed. This is particularly true if safety features are not in place. Children shouldn't be allowed to sit on the top bunk during the daytime. In the ideal scenario, only one person can use the top bunk at any given time.
